You can use EndNote to find the full-text articles for references in your EndNote library. To do this, you need to set EndNote up to connect to our e-journal subscriptions. 

1. Open EndNote library 

2. Select Edit - Preferences - Find full text - tick "Open Url" and enter the below: 

OpenURL Path: https://find.shef.ac.uk/openurl/44SFD_INST/44SFD_INST:SP?

Authenticate With URL: https://sheffield.idm.oclc.org/login?url

3. Click "apply"

4. In your Library, Right click on one of the records and select authenticate. 

5. A dialogue box appears - Sign in to MUSE (MFA)

The find full text function should now work. 

6. Right click on one of the records and select Find Full text- see the Find full text section on the left hand menu for progress. 

Please note that Endnote may not be able to find full text in all cases - you can always attach PDFs manually to references if Find Full Text doesn’t work.
